Solar water heater: your hot water heated for free by the sun

The individual solar water heater (SDHW) captures the sun’s heat with thermal collectors, transfers it to a heat-transfer fluid, then to a tank via an exchanger. In Belgium, it covers 50 to 65% of your hot water needs over the year. The backup takes over in winter — you pay nothing for the sun.

Technical specifications

What a solar water heater is really worth

The figures that matter for a well-sized SDHW under the Belgian climate. Concrete benchmarks, not marketing.

  • Type of collectors
    Flat or tubes

    Flat collectors, robust and economical, suit most roofs. Evacuated tubes, more efficient in low sunlight and cold, capture the Belgian winter better — at a higher cost.

  • Coverage rate
    50–65% over the year

    Over an average year in Belgium, solar covers 50 to 65% of domestic hot water needs: nearly 100% in summer, far less in winter. Hence the indispensable backup during the dark months.

  • Tank volume
    200–300 L

    The solar tank with exchanger is sized to the household’s consumption: about 50 litres per person. Too small, it stores the summer surplus poorly; too large, the backup works too hard.

  • Collector surface
    4–6 m²

    For a household of 4, count on 4 to 6 m² of collectors facing south, tilted at 35–45°. The surface is matched to the tank volume to avoid summer overheating.

  • Backup
    Indispensable

    The Belgian winter is not enough: a backup (electric element, boiler or heat pump) tops up the tank when the sun falls short. It is what guarantees hot water all year round.

  • Fluid & pump
    Glycol + pump

    An antifreeze water-glycol mix circulates in a closed loop between the collectors and the exchanger, driven by a controlled pump. A regulator stops the pump when the tank is warmer than the collectors.

* Indicative values for a standard domestic SDHW. The exact sizing (collectors, tank, backup) depends on your consumption and your roof — confirmed during the study.

Pros & cons of the solar water heater

No solution is perfect for every household. Here, honestly, is where the SDHW excels and where you should look elsewhere.

Where it shines

  • 100% free energyThe sun heats your water with no bill: 50 to 65% of needs covered over the year.
  • Very low footprintNo combustion or electricity for the solar share: lasting CO₂ savings.
  • Proven technologyReliable collectors and tanks, over 20 years’ lifespan with minimal maintenance.
  • Subsidies availableWallonia and Brussels support the SDHW, which clearly shortens the payback period.

What to keep in mind

  • Backup mandatory in winterSolar alone is not enough from November to February: a backup remains indispensable.
  • Covers hot water, not heatingAn SDHW targets domestic hot water; to heat the home, that is another system.
  • Initial investmentMore expensive to buy than a simple water heater, even if subsidies narrow the gap.
  • Circuit maintenanceThe glycol and the pump require periodic checks to keep the output up.

Solar water heater FAQ

Your questions about the SDHW

Does the solar water heater work in winter in Belgium? +

Partly. The collectors produce all year, but the low sunlight from November to February is not enough to cover all the needs. That is why a backup (electric element, boiler or heat pump) takes over in winter. Over the year, solar still covers 50 to 65% of your hot water.

Flat collectors or evacuated tubes? +

Flat collectors are robust, economical and suit most Belgian roofs. Evacuated tubes capture better in low sunlight and cold weather, so they improve the winter solar share, but cost more. The choice depends on your roof, your budget and your winter expectations.

What is the difference with a heat-pump water heater? +

A solar water heater uses thermal collectors to recover the sun’s heat. A heat-pump water heater is in fact a heat pump that draws heat from the ambient air, using electricity: it is not solar. The heat-pump model is self-sufficient all year and needs no roof collectors.

What collector surface and tank volume? +

For a household of four, you generally plan 4 to 6 m² of collectors and a 200 to 300 litre tank, about 50 litres per person. The sizing is matched to your real consumption to avoid both a hot-water shortage and summer overheating.

What maintenance does a solar water heater need? +

Maintenance stays light but necessary: you must periodically check the heat-transfer fluid (antifreeze water-glycol mix), the circuit pressure and the proper operation of the pump and regulator. A check every few years preserves the output and the longevity of the installation, which exceeds 20 years.
